do you think that tianshans relationship is too violent??? or do you think that’s just their dynamic???
Hello, dear anon!
That is a tricky question for sure. I have talked about my take on violence-related topics a couple of times before:
Is Tianshan toxic part 1 and part 2
HT as a discipliner for MGS
Violence in Zhanhyi vs. violence in Tianshan
Was HT too pushy with MGS? (ch. 333 extra)
HT with JY vs. HT with MGS
My Tianshan “timeline” and its continuum
You would probably be the most interested in my comparison of Zhanyi and Tianshan when it comes to violence. But I would recommend taking an overall look.
“do you think that tianshans relationship is too violent or do you think that’s just their dynamic”
Whenever it comes to these kinds of questions, I like to keep two things in mind: context and subjectivity. I think context matters when it comes to whatever we’re doing. It doesn’t excuse the things that have been done but it explains them. And if I can understand the reasons/see behind the behavior, to me it changes how I feel about said thing.
Secondly, I’ve found that these kinds of questions are surprisingly subjective. As you said yourself, do I think their relationship is too violent? I don’t think anyone can deny that their relationship has violence in it, but am I bothered by it? We all have different tastes when it comes to fictional dynamics. Some people take issue with the violence in Tianshan, and that’s valid. To them, it’s too much and puts them off. To some other people, it doesn't make them uncomfortable. They are not bothered by it at all. Then there are all the rest (like myself) who are sprinkled somewhere in between the two opposites on the spectrum.
Now, I think that situation is perfectly fine, but issues come up when people start to moralize others who are placed somewhere else on that spectrum than themselves. Thinking Tianshan is (too) violent is perfectly acceptable, but saying things like “you are gross/toxic/messed up for shipping something like Tianshan” isn’t. In my books, at least. (I’m sorry, dear anon, I know you weren't saying anything like that! I just wanted to finish where I was going with all this.)
Anyway, I think those two principles apply to the violence in Tianshan as well.
When it comes to 19 Days, especially, I would say context is quite important. A lot of the humor in the comic is based on the boys physically hurting each other. This goes for Tianshan, too (ch. 150, 160, 170, 256. 281, 298, 339):
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
MGS slaps and punches HT. HT twists his balls and pushes him down. I get it if that’s not exactly funny to everyone, but it’s still how 19 Days’ comedy works. The characters aren’t left with injuries or trauma; usually the slaps are forgotten and bloody noses healed by the next panel. For the most part, I find the comedic moments funny.
In general, I think the type of comedy that 19 Days has is where the Chinese/Asian and Western fandoms clash culturally. I’m not that familiar with Chinese comedy tropes, but from what I’ve understood it’s not uncommon that teenage boys mess with each other physically like that in Chinese culture. Especially, that whole “twisting the balls” thing. (Please, someone correct me if I’m completely wrong about this! This is just what I’ve heard from non-Western people.)
Other than comedy, context is also important to keep in mind when it comes to other occasions of violence between HT and MGS. I think the best example of this was when HT confronted MGS about his past with SL and got physical with MGS (ch. 295):
Tumblr media
I remember there was a lot of fandom discussion about this moment. A lot of people felt like HT had gone back to his old ways and he was forcing MGS again. Ultimately, it was seen as him being abusive and toxic.
And to be fair, I think they were right in saying that HT regressed to his old habits. I would say that was the whole point of that moment. SL lurking around and his veiled threats towards MGS had put HT on edge. He was restless and uneasy about the whole situation. It was made even worse by how he was basically left on the blind side of everything since he didn't know what SL was holding over MGS’s head. So, it wasn’t a surprise that his impatience and uneasiness came out as him using physical strength on MGS.
Again, people who (still) were turned off by HT’s behavior are valid and I can see where they are coming from. But there were reasons as to why HT was behaving in such ways. To some, the reasons don’t matter because they don't change the actions themselves. And they would be correct in saying so, but I think those reasons are still important to keep in mind when interpreting moments like these.
As I said, this topic is also about subjectivity and I put myself somewhere between the two ends of the spectrum. For the most part, I’m not bothered by the violence in Tianshan. I can see its comedic purposes or I’m interested in it for contextual reasons. But there have been occasions when I’ve been somewhat uncomfortable with the violence or that it’s come across needlessly rough to me. (Even if I have understood the context behind it.)
Sometimes I’m a bit taken aback by the roughness of the violence (ch. 138, 222, 234):
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
These panels always came across a bit extreme to me. I can see the build-up context behind them and understand where the blow-up stemmed from (MGS talking back to HT, and HT pushing MGS’s buttons after he had been worried for HT). But they still make me kinda go “okay... 🥴“. These moments were too much for me, personally, even if Tianshan is my OTP. 
There have also been a couple of occasions when HT’s pushiness makes me a bit uncomfortable (ch. 174, 333, 342 [the last translation is by @1154lizz 🖤]):
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
And again, I see the context behind these moments - HT taking a joke too far, “touch my balls” kind of comedy, and...I guess taking the overall “pushy vs. tsundere” to the extreme. The first two moments I have somewhat gotten more comfortable with later on. I think the first kiss served as a good reflection point for both characters. HT trying to make MGS massage his balls as revenge goes in the overall category of 19 Days humor for me. The last panels are probably the only ones that still make me cringe. I think it’s mostly about how the situation is portrayed because when HT was stripping MGS to go swimming in the earlier chapters it didn't make me uncomfortable at all.
So, when you ask is Tianshan “too violent” or is it “just their dynamic”, I think those two things can coexist. It’s not an either-or situation to me. I would say violence is a part of the Tianshan dynamics. (Violence is also a big part of 19 Days in general.) HT pushes while MGS pulls. And as two strong-willed characters, they also clash a lot. And I love those things about them. That dynamic is partly why I’m drawn to them.
But the violence can still be too much to me or other people. It’s possible that kind of dynamics isn't to someone’s taste in general, and the violence makes them uncomfortable. It’s also possible that occasionally the violence goes too far even if you shipped Tianshan. I don’t think you can say there is some universal level of “this much violence is fine” without making it sound like you’re moralizing. It’s different for everyone. I’m sure some people have been perfectly fine with the things that have made me uncomfortable, and I don't see a problem in that. As a Tianshan shipper, the “it’s so toxic/violent/abusive” discourse can get a bit tiring at times, but as long as we’re talking about the ship (and not the shippers), I think everyone is free to voice their interpretations.

Note
hello!! I am a fellow Ugetsu fan (I feel we are not many but growing ever bigger in number!), I really like all your Ugetsu meta and I wanted to ask what, for you personally, would be a good point for Ugetsu’s character arc by the end of the manga. I hope we get more content from him from sensei!! And if we do, what would you like to see?
Hello there, dear fellow Ugetsu fan!
It’s always so nice to meet other Ugetsu fans! I feel like the movie grew our numbers a little. Based on what I’ve heard, seeing Ugetsu in the movie made people see him differently and sympathize with him more.
And thank you for reading my Ugetsu musings! I’m glad to hear you’ve enjoyed them.
“what, for you personally, would be a good point for Ugetsu’s character arc by the end of the manga”
This is a very good question. I think my personal vision for Ugetsu’s “endpoint” is based on what we saw in the Ugetsu extra booklet that was published with the Blueray release of the movie. I think there were a few more prominent points in there that hint at what Ugetsu’s future will look like. You can find pictures of the booklet HERE and separate English translations HERE.
Ugetsu and Mafuyu
Mafuyu congratulating Ugetsu for his win and Ugetsu sending him a squirrel “thank you” sticker made me so happy:
Tumblr media
I really wish Mafuyu and Ugetsu will stay in touch and Ugetsu will remain connected to the story through that friendship. I understand that the whole Ugetsu-Akihiko-Haruki arch is done now, but I could definitely see Ugetsu popping up via Mafuyu. I feel like their friendship and how they seemed to connect would be so important to Ugetsu. With Mafuyu, he would feel like someone out there does understand/listen to him. Mafuyu not only sees Ugetsu but also tries to reach him. He hears what Ugetsu is trying to say and is able to put those things into his own music which talks to Ugetsu in return. I don't think Ugetsu has that with anyone else.
So, in the end, I could see Ugetsu still being part of the story via Mafuyu. As I’ve said before, I really don't think Kizu wrote Ugetsu as some kind of villain. He isn’t an evil witch who needs to be cast out in the end. I think his relationship with Mafuyu supports that discourse and I really hope Mafuyu seeing Ugetsu as human will keep reminding the readers of that.
Ugetsu and Akihiko
Akihiko sent Ugetsu a text saying “Congrats” and Ugetsu talks about how someday the butterfly will grow beautiful wings:
Tumblr media
When the booklet came out, I saw people - both AkiHaru shippers and Ugetsu stans - being worried about that text Akihiko sent Ugetsu. People seemed to take the message as Akihiko still being hung up on Ugetsu even if he’s already going out with Haruki. Others saw it as Akihiko being toxic because he was causing Ugetsu pain by staying in touch.
Personally, I could see Ugetsu and Akihiko remaining somewhat like friends even after the break-up. They didn't break up hating each other. Their break-up was more about being finally able to let go of each other, not about one of them doing something that broke their relationship and caused the other to hate his guts. In the end, they were both hurting and knew that they were better apart.
I think Kizu making Akihiko send that text was a representation of what Ugetsu talked about with Mafuyu before the AkiUgetsu break-up (vol. 5 ch. 27):
Tumblr media Tumblr media
In Given, “music” has a lot of symbolic value and drive. It’s this infinite, abstract place that stores memories and people who have been important to the characters. But it also represents new relationships and keeps shifting in nature. AkiUgetsu had their own kind of music, and now Akihiko is playing a new kind of music with Haruki. But music will always remain.
Music will keep Akihiko and Ugetsu connected on some level. Even if they are no longer in a romantic relationship, they will always share “music”. It’s where their shared memories reside (what they used to be). It’s where they can see each other (what they are now). None of that means they are still hung up on each other. They are not getting back together. It’s more of a parallel to how Mafuyu is still connected to Yuki via music. A new dawn is breaking for both Ugetsu and Mafuyu, but music is always left behind from those previous relationships while it’s also the way for both of them to move forward.
Another thing about them remaining in contact via music is that despite everything, I think Ugetsu is happy for Akihiko. In the booklet, he talked about how neither of them was able to spread their wings in the suffocating basement. Ugetsu was unable to be free with his music whereas Akihiko had lost his passion for his music. I think Ugetsu seeing Akihiko play the violin again - playing it with motivation, drive, and a purpose - would make him happy. After all, it’s what he had wanted for Akihiko all this time. It might be laced with bitter-sweetness (like nearly all happiness in Given) for Ugetsu, but ultimately I think it would give him joy to see Akihiko fly.
So, personally I can see Akihiko still being a part of Ugetsu’s life even a little in the end.
Ugetsu’s future relationships - yay or nay?
I’ve seen people talk about if they would like Ugetsu to end up finding another love interest by the time Given ends. Some seem to prefer he didn’t while others would be interested in seeing him find someone.
Personally, I would say I’m fine with either path but lean more towards him remaining by himself in the end. First of all, I think Ugetsu finding himself a new love interest wouldn’t be a good idea pacing-wise. It would come too fast. Akihiko was already in love with Haruki by the time AkiUgetsu broke up. Living at Haruki’s place had made him realize that he had loved Ugetsu but now it was painful and suffocating.
I believe Ugetsu, on the other hand, still loved Akihiko when Akihiko finally broke up with him. That’s why it had to be Akihiko who let go of Ugetsu’s hand and walked away in the end. Ugetsu was hurting in their relationship, but he still “loved Akihiko to death”. Of course, we don't know how long it will still take for Given to finish, but I feel like it would still be too soon for Ugetsu.
Secondly, I feel like Ugetsu falling in love with someone new would defeat his overall “character”. A part of why he wanted to break up with Akihiko was how his love for Akihiko affected his music. He became more occupied with Akihiko and chased him instead of his music. I’m not saying he can never fall in love with anyone, but rather that he is now free to pursue music like had wanted to. He can now spread his wings, too, without worrying about snuffing out someone else’s.
Also, I think Ugetsu’s character could represent the idea that you don't need a romantic relationship to feel happy and fulfilled. Ugetsu strikes me as the type who could find those things in his music and be “independent” like that. If after everything he said about wanting to chase his music he began another relationship, it would somewhat reverse the journey he went through in the comic. I think if he found another romantic interest, they would have to be a well-fleshed-out character, and I’m not sure if the comic really has time for that. I wouldn’t want Ugetsu’s new partner to be some kind of sidenote in the margins since falling in love (again) would be such a big thing for Ugetsu’s character.
Overall, I’m not against Ugetsu finding someone new per se but I just think it’s not a good idea because of pacing and what it would mean for Ugetsu’s overall character development. I think it would be better if he takes time to pursue his music, figure himself out more and go for some adventures on his own, and that’s where we leave him off once Given ends.
In general, I think Ugetsu will be just fine in the end. I don’t personally want to be an angst-monger when it comes to his future. He went through something painful and is recovering but he seems to be determined to find new kind of happiness.
